1997Movie82 minEnglish

In this sensual horror tale, Paul Stevens is transported to a mysterious world where he is surrounded by strange and beautiful women, led by Tara Coventry. Tara initiates Paul into their world of bizarre erotic rituals; however Tara and her minions are actually practitioners of black magic, who are trying to snare Paul's soul through their sexual mischief. Will he realize the evil he has fallen into before it is too late?
